Identifiers for ANDREW DIAMOND
Identifiers are used to associate other provider identifiers such as Medicaid or other insurers (ie:, Blue Cross, Blue Shield, Aetna, Kaiser-Permanente, etc.), with their NPI number. These identifiers can be used in matching an NPI number to an insurer's records. However, not all providers have such numbers and not all providers choose to include them in their NPI information.

Health Information Exchange (HEI)
HEI is the mobilization of health care information electronically across organizations within a region, community or hospital system. Endpoints provide a simple and secure way for participants to send authenticated, encrypted health information directly to known, trusted recipients over the internet such as primary care physicians, specialists, hospitals, labs, etc.
